Review of We Are What We Are (2010) by Phil N — 23 Sep 2010
Hoping to replicate what Let The Right One In did for vampire films, We Are What We Are attempts to bring arthouse sensibilities to a story of a cannibal family living in Mexico. When their father dies, who will take up the role of providing food for the rest of the family? Despite a promising start and an intriguing set up, the film is achingly slow and by the time anything actually happens youâ??re past caring.
Or at least I wasâ?¦.
